  • Getting Organized with Seat Sacks

    Funded Sep 14, 2018

    Thank you so much for funding my project to get seat sacks on all twenty-five of my students' chairs. I can't express how happy I was to check my email and see that this project was funded.

    Organization is everything in kindergarten. An organized classroom allows me to be a better teacher. When I started the school year, the students' desks were a mess with papers, books, and pencil cases shoved in them. It was a shame to see some books already bent. The delivery of the seat sacks allowed me to teach the students how to better organize themselves. Having the seat sacks helps to prevent the kids' books from getting damaged. The students love their new organization tool. My classroom looks great and it is due to your generosity!

    This is a gift that I hope lasts a few school years. Thank you for supporting my NYC public school students!”

  • Flexible Learning - Bringing Yoga to the Classroom Library

    Funded Dec 11, 2012

    I cannot express how THANKFUL I am for your generous donation to my students. The yoga books and materials are used every single day in our first grade classrooms. I have been teaching yoga to 150 first graders each week, and the donated materials are encouraging students that they can be independent learners. They are thrilled to discover more about yoga through books and the yoga cards. They love reading about new yoga moves, breaths to either calm or energize themselves, and stories about people doing yoga.

    In our persuasive writing unit, we also discussed the power of writing a letter to help solve a problem. The kids related to our problem of not having yoga books, and are encouraged and amazed that you all agreed and decided to support yoga in our classrooms. It was a thrill to open the box filled with brand new yoga books!!!

    My school's first grade student population is mostly comprised of English language learners. I wish you were able to see the smile on their faces as we explore new yoga moves. As an educator, it is wonderful to see students who sometimes struggle in class SUCCEED! Yoga is a tool that provides my students an even playing ground. Regardless of language proficiency, we all are masters of certain yoga moves. Truly, we appreciate your generosity and hope you know that there is a little more laughter, flexibility, and exploration going on within the classroom.”

I am fortunate to be a teacher instructing students at one of the most culturally diverse schools in the State of New York. My students are native New Yorkers or come from countries such as Bangladesh, China, Yemen, Ecuador, Colombia, India, and Pakistan. My students are united in our classroom in Queens, the language capital of the world. They are enthusiastic learners who want to be successful in school and my job is to advocate to create the best classroom environment for this wonderful crew.
